Those who live in glass houses shouldn't throw stones. Let's take a look at how our beloved Redskins did in years past with their first pick:

2005 - CB Carlos Rogers (solid pick)
2004 - S Sean Taylor (solid pick)
2003 - WR Taylor Jacobs (who is this guy?)
2002 - QB Patrick Ramsey (Jet)
2001 - QR Rod Gardner (is he still playing in the NFL?)
2000 - LB Lavar Arrington (never played up to full potential)
1999 - CB Champ Bailey (now a Bronco)
1998 - TE Stephen Alexander (never played up to full potential)
1997 - DE Kenard Lang (I liked this guy while he was here)
1996 - OT Andre Johnson (is he still playing in the NFL?)
1995 - WR Michael Westbrook (ha ha ha ha ha ha)
1994 - QB Heath Shuler (again, ha ha ha ha ha ha)
1993 - DB Tom Carter (whatever happened to this guy)
1992 - WR Desmond Howard (what a waste of a pick)

You get the idea. It's hard to make fun of the Jets draft mistakes when we sure had our share ourselves!

We have had a much better track record drafting than the Jets. My comments are in caps...

2005 - CB Carlos Rogers (solid pick - AGREED, COULD END UP BEING OUR #1 CB FOR YEARS)

2004 - S Sean Taylor (solid pick - AGREED BIG TIME, A STUD SAFETY)

2003 - WR Taylor Jacobs (who is this guy? - A 2ND ROUND PICK - HAS BEEN HURT A LOT, I THINK HE'LL BE A GOOD PLAYER ONE DAY. MAYBE NOT A #1 BUT POSSIBLY A GOOD #2. WR IS A FUNNY POSITION, IT TAKES SOME GUYS LONGER. I HEAR THAT THE SKINS DBS THINK HE'S GOOD.)

2002 - QB Patrick Ramsey (Jet - LAST PICK IN THE FIRST ROUND FOR US, COULD END BEING A GOOD SOLID B-UP QB)

2001 - QR Rod Gardner (is he still playing in the NFL? - PACKERS JUST RE-SIGNED HIM...A GOOD 3RD WR, BUT NO MORE)

2000 - LB Lavar Arrington (never played up to full potential - AGREED, KNEE INJURY 2 YEARS BACK HURT HIM A LOT. ON THE RIGHT TEAM, A 3-4, COULD BE A PLAYER)

1999 - CB Champ Bailey (now a Bronco -- BUT, WE GOT PORTIS FOR HIM, SO NO WAY IS THIS CONSIDERED A WASTED PICK)

1998 - TE Stephen Alexander (never played up to full potential - AGREED..WAS HE A 2ND ROUND PICK TOO? ALSO GOT HURT TOO MUCH)

1997 - DE Kenard Lang (I liked this guy while he was here - ME TOO, NOW A FA PLAYER. THE YEAR WE PICKED HIM WAS A BAD YEAR FOR DL. HIS TEAMMATE, DRAFTED JUST AFTER LANG, DIDN'T DOMINATE EITHER)

1996 - OT Andre Johnson (is he still playing in the NFL? - NEVER PLAYED, A REAL DUD. I BELIEVE HE WAS THE LAST PICK IN THE 1ST ROUND. HARD TO BELIEVE HE WAS SO OVERRATED.)

1995 - WR Michael Westbrook (ha ha ha ha ha ha - HURT A LOT, VERY ATHLETIC BUT DIDN'T GET ALONG WITH ANYONE, PLAYERS OR COACHES. MADE THE SPECTACULAR CATCH BUT DROPPED THE EASY ONE)

1994 - QB Heath Shuler (again, ha ha ha ha ha ha - AGREED...I THOUGHT FOR SURE HE WAS GOING TO BE GREAT. IT'S SO HARD TO PREDICT QBS.)

1993 - DB Tom Carter (whatever happened to this guy - PLAYED FOR BEARS FOR A NUMBER OF YEARS, I THINK. DIDN'T DO ANYTHING FOR US, WAS STARTER FOR BEARS INITIALLY, THEN WENT TO NICKLE OR DIME BACK)

1992 - WR Desmond Howard (what a waste of a pick - SURE WAS. GREAT PUNT RETURNER TERRIBLE ROUTE RUNNER, LAZY, ETC...DIDN'T GIBBS WANT HIM?)
